where are you planning for with Krisflyer ?
You can book tickets to Europe using star alliance for 30.5k Krisflyer miles. It's second best in terms of reward redemption and you can add upto 5 nominees without any fuss. The best is Turkish Miles and Smiles but I have faced issued booking from them and currently I am unable to book AI flights through Turkish Miles and Smiles.

Currently I have -
Turkish Miles and Smiles - 19k (Had transferred for booking Europe flight but unable to do it).
Krisflyer - 1,20,000 miles
Accor - 1,54,000 miles(after today's transfer)
Marriot - 5,000
IHG - 3,000

I majorly use Turkish, Krisflyer and Accor(before Accor it was Marriot and IHG) for my international trips.
 
I transferred major chunk of miles to Krisflyer and Accor as I will be using them for international trips.
